The Arizona rotation has gone through several recent changes, and there may be more on the way. Opening Day starter Josh Collmenter (RHP, ARI) was sent to the bullpen and top prospect Archie Bradley (RHP, ARI) hit the DL with shoulder tendinitis. Perhaps related to the injury, Bradley's ugly 5.6 Ctl over eight starts has doomed his overall performance, and it's quite evident he'll need some more seasoning in the minor leagues. Collmenter's xERA has been above 4.00 every season since 2012, and it ballooned to a career-worst 4.61 through 12 starts this season.
